First, the Thunderbird Office unlocked their doors 20 minutes late. This resulted in about a dozen individuals crammed into a small waiting area which made social distancing impossible. When an older lady in a wheelchair was called to move into the test area, no one would open the door and hold it for her. She became quite upset and had to rely on other customers to help her. Second, I wanted to be certain my doctor requested a particular test that was quite important to me, so I asked a Labcorp staff member to check my order and be certain it was there. I was told the test was requested and would be performed. When I visited my doctor to review the test results, I was told the particular test I asked about was not performed - the LabCorp staff lied to me. Poor customer service. Lie to customers. I won't be back!

I received an email from Labcorp confirming my appointment and it stated “please either print out your documentation or show it from your mobile device.” Check-in was easy with a kiosk and I was impressed that they are ahead of the game compared to most doctor’s offices that have a lot of paperwork to fill out. Then the office admin called me to the desk and told me they needed the document printed out. I showed her the email where it states it can be from the mobile device, and asked if I could email it and they could print it there. She said they couldn’t because their fax machine was broken. She said if I want I can go to a FedEx and print it out. I ended up going to 3 FedEx locations outlined and Google, and they aren’t updated. The first one was an On-site at Walgreens that couldn’t print it out. The second, a US Postal Office near by that doesn’t have a printer. And third wasn’t even a FedEx, it was a Whataburger. All of this could have been avoided if the email outlined proper expectations or if the admin assistant could have been willing to work with me and accepted electronic version instead. I didn’t even go back because I was so frustrated and an hour wasted in my working day.
